Job Title: Finance Manager
Reports to: Chairman
Job Purpose:
The Finance Manager will play a crucial role in overseeing the financial operations of the group of companies, with a focus on budgeting, forecasting, financial reporting, and strategic planning. This role involves working closely with the senior management team to ensure the financial health of the organization, ensuring compliance with accounting standards, and supporting business growth. The Finance Manager will also work closely with project managers and the project team to monitor project budgets and financial performance.
Key Responsibilities
- Financial Planning and Analysis: Lead the annual budgeting process, ensuring alignment with the company’s strategic goals and objectives.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ial forecasts, providing insights into potential financial risks and opportunities. Conduct variance analysis and provide actionable recommendations to senior management for improving financial performance. Analyze financial data and trends to support decision-making processes.
- Project Financial Management: Work closely with project managers and teams to track project costs, timelines, and profitability. Ensure project budgets are adhered to and monitor project cash flows to identify potential financial issues. Provide financial oversight for projects, ensuring accurate cost estimation, financial modeling, and risk assessment. Review project financial reports and advise stakeholders on cost-saving strategies.
- Project Estimation and Cost Planning: Lead the financial estimation and costing for new projects, ensuring accurate and comprehensive cost breakdowns based on scope and historical project data. Collaborate with the project team to assess and provide detailed cost estimates for labor, materials, equipment, and other resources. Ensure that project estimations align with the company’s pricing models and cost control frameworks. Work with the project team to update project budgets based on changes in scope, design, or materials throughout the project lifecycle. Assess project risks and their potential financial impact, adjusting estimates and financial plans as necessary to mitigate risk.
- Financial Reporting and Compliance: Prepare accurate and timely financial statements, including P&L, balance sheet, and cash flow statements, in accordance with accounting standards. Oversee the preparation and filing of tax returns and 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ations. Coordinate with external auditors to ensure smooth and successful audits. Ensure the company’s financial practices and policies are in compliance with relevant laws and regulations.
- Cash Flow and Risk Management: Monitor and manage company cash flow, ensuring sufficient liquidity to meet operational and project needs. Identify financial risks and implement mitigation strategies. Assist in negotiating contracts with clients, suppliers, and subcontractors to optimize financial outcomes. Develop and implement strategies for debt management and capital structure optimization.
- Team Leadership and Development: Manage and mentor the finance team, providing guidance on accounting principles, financial processes, and best practices. Foster a collaborative and efficient work environment, ensuring high levels of performance and accountability. Support the professional development of the finance team through training, feedback, and career growth opportunities.
- Technology and Systems Integration: Work with IT teams to integrate financial tracking and reporting systems, ensuring smooth financial data flow across departments. Leverage financial management tools to improve the accuracy and efficiency of financial reporting, forecasting, and cost estimation. Stay up to date with advancements in financial management tools and industry trends to ensure the company’s systems remain effective and efficient.

Desired Candidate Profile
-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or a related field; CPA or CFA certification preferred.
- Minimum of 8 years of experience in finance management, ideally within the engineering or construction industry.
- Strong knowledge of financial principles, accounting practices, and financial modeling.
- Experience with project-based accounting, including cost management and budget forecasting in an engineering or construction environment.
- Expertise in financial reporting and analysis, with proficiency in accounting software and ERP systems.
- Ability to interpret and apply financial data in a strategic manner to support company growth and profitability.
- Strong communication skills, with the ability to present complex financial information to non-financial stakeholders.
- Leadership and team management experience, with the ability to inspire and drive performance.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office 365 suite (Outlook,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Teams, etc.).
